The golden hour is a magical period during sunrise and sunset when the lighting creates a warm and inviting ambiance in photographs. Photographers often strive to capture this enchanting effect, but sometimes the perfect lighting is elusive. Fortunately, with the right photo editing techniques in Photoshop, you can recreate the stunning golden hour effect in any image.
